Rebounding Dominance
Anthony Davis's rebounding dominance is a crucial aspect of his game, and his 2021 stats reflect his significant impact on the boards. Total rebounds per game (RPG) is a key statistic to consider, showing how effectively he secures missed shots for his team. However, it's also important to differentiate between offensive and defensive rebounds. Offensive rebounds provide second-chance opportunities for his team, while defensive rebounds limit the opponent's possessions. A player who excels in both categories demonstrates a well-rounded rebounding ability.
His rebounding percentage further illustrates his prowess on the boards. This metric calculates the percentage of available rebounds a player grabs while on the court, providing a clearer picture of his rebounding efficiency relative to his playing time. It helps to normalize the data, accounting for players who might have high rebound numbers simply because they play more minutes. Comparing his rebounding percentage to other players in the league gives a better sense of his true impact as a rebounder.

Defensive Impact
The defensive impact of Anthony Davis goes beyond simple statistics; however, his 2021 stats provide valuable insights into his contributions on that end of the court. Blocks per game (BPG) is an obvious indicator of his shot-blocking ability and rim protection. A high BPG suggests that he deters opponents from driving to the basket and challenges shots effectively. Steals per game (SPG) reflects his ability to anticipate passes and disrupt the opponent's offense. A player with high SPG demonstrates excellent awareness and quick hands.
His defensive rating is a comprehensive metric that evaluates his overall defensive performance. It estimates how many points a team allows per 100 possessions with him on the court. A low defensive rating indicates that he is a strong defender who contributes to limiting the opponent's scoring. Additionally, consider his defensive win shares, which estimate the number of wins a player contributes to his team through his defensive play. This statistic helps quantify his overall impact on the team's defensive success.

Impact on Team Performance
Anthony Davis's impact on team performance in 2021 can be assessed through various metrics. His presence on the court undoubtedly affected the Los Angeles Lakers' overall success. The team's win-loss record with and without him provides a clear indication of his importance. A significant difference in the team's winning percentage highlights his value as a key player.
His plus-minus rating is another valuable metric to consider. This statistic measures the point differential when he is on the court compared to when he is off the court. A positive plus-minus rating indicates that the team performs better with him on the court, while a negative rating suggests the opposite. Analyzing his plus-minus rating in different game situations β such as close games or against specific opponents β provides further insights into his impact.
